Most of our clients have all heard this schpeel, but for those who haven’t booked us yet or haven’t booked an engagement shoot with us yet I’ll reiterate what we’ve been saying for awhile: do something that MEANS something to you both. An activity you actually do. While frolicking in a field at sunset is always gorgeous, there’s this authenticity that comes out when our clients choose to do something that they do with each other normally. It especially helps with people who aren’t fond of having their photographs taken, as is the case with most of our grooms.
